Islamabad: The Islamabad High Court (IHC) Monday disposed of the petition filed by Chief Minister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Ali Amin Gandapur to meet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) founder Imran Khan over withdrawal.
According to the details, Islamabad High Court Chief Justice Aamer Farooq heard the petiton of Chief Minister Khyber Pakhtunkhwa.
During the hearing, the assistant of Ali Amin Gandapur's lawyer Zahoor-ul-Hasan requested to withdraw the application saying that they had filed a request for a meeting however the meeting was conducted.
The assistant lawyer stated that after the meeting, they withdraw the application. The court accepted the request to withdraw the application and disposed it off.
